PATEK PHILIPPE, REF. 5079J

EXTREMELY FINE AND RARE YELLOW GOLD AUTOMATIC MINUTE REPEATING WRISTWATCH WITH BLACK DIAL AND GOLD BREGUET NUMERALS, LIMITED EDITION MADE FOR THE 50TH ANNIVERSARY OF GEORGE PRAGNELL LTD.
MOVEMENT 1904153, CASE 4261706, MANUFACTURED IN 2004

Calibre R 27 PS, Geneva Seal hallmarked, 39 jewels, Gyromax balance, free sprung regulator, 22k gold minirotor, repeating on two gongs via hammers, black matte dial, gold Breguet numerals, small seconds, three-part case in 18k gold, snap on case back engraved commemorative inscription 50 Golden Years 1954 George Pragnell 2004, repeating slide in the band, 18k gold PPCo buckle, case, dial and movement signed
Diameter: 42 mm.

Lot Essay

US$250,000-300,000
EUR180,000-210,000

With Patek Philippe presentation box, Certificate of Origin, product literature and spare transparent case back.

In 2004 the firm of Patek Philippe manufactured a very special series of 5 limited edition wristwatches to celebrate the 50th anniversary of their relationship with George Pragnell ltd, one of the largest retailers of luxury watches in the United Kingdom based outside of London in Stratford upon Avon .

The present lot, one of these five extremely rare examples is fitted with the sought after black dial, Breguet numerals and "Cathedral" repeating mechanism, consisting of a high-tone and a low-tone gong translating into a much richer and fuller sound, resembling the chime of the bells of a cathedral.

Reference 5079 was introduced to the market in 2001 with the standard version being fitted with a white enamel dial (See lot 2654) and black numerals. The reference is fitted with the ingenious calibre R 27 PS that impresses not only by its remarkable number of 342 parts but also by Patek Philippe's mastery watch making by combining a micro-rotor and a minute repeating mechanism.
